blob: 5c744e430d5907e9394cafd76b71bfd3fd8663f0 [file] [log] [blame]
{
children: [
{
name: "system-updater",
url: "fuchsia-pkg://fuchsia.com/system-updater#meta/system-updater.cm",
startup: "eager",
},
],
use: [
{
protocol: "fuchsia.update.installer.Installer",
from: "#system-updater",
},
],
offer: [
{
protocol: [ "fuchsia.cobalt.LoggerFactory" ],
from: "#cobalt",
to: "#system-updater",
},
{
protocol: "fuchsia.pkg.PackageResolver",
from: "#pkg-resolver",
to: "#system-updater",
},
{
protocol: [
"fuchsia.pkg.PackageCache",
"fuchsia.pkg.RetainedPackages",
"fuchsia.space.Manager",
],
from: "#pkg-cache",
to: "#system-updater",
},
{
protocol: [ "fuchsia.logger.LogSink" ],
from: "parent",
to: [ "#system-updater" ],
},
{
protocol: [
"fuchsia.hardware.power.statecontrol.Admin",
"fuchsia.paver.Paver",
],
from: "parent",
to: "#system-updater",
},
{
directory: "system",
from: "parent",
as: "pkgfs-system",
to: "#system-updater",
},
{
directory: "build-info",
from: "parent",
to: "#system-updater",
},
{
storage: "data",
from: "self",
to: "#system-updater",
},
],
}